## Zero-Downtime Schema Migration — Step 4

For the Larkspur release, apply migrations in expand-then-contract order: add nullable columns first, deploy dual-write code, backfill, then drop old columns in a later release. Verify the backfill worker on Quillgate completes before cutover. To trigger the backfill via the migration service, authenticate with the key below.

service key, fawip-bajef: kto11_Qt5wZK9vdNC

Every retry against the Ledgerfall payment gateway must carry an idempotency key derived from the originating order token, not the attempt number, so that network-level replays collapse into a single charge. Keys are stored in the Quillbank dedup table with a TTL comfortably longer than the longest plausible retry window, and expired keys are never reused. The retry and expiry parameters were validated during the Ashmere load trials; the agreed constants follow below.

tuning table, yajog-yahof:
BUDGETS = {
    "lamvan": 303,
    "wenox": 460,
    "fenvan": 525,
}

## Step 4: Slim the Brindlecore base image

Before promoting the slimmed image to the Varnholt registry, strip build toolchains and docs from the final stage. Brindlecore's multi-stage Dockerfile already separates compile and runtime layers; your job is to confirm the runtime stage pulls only the distroless base and the compiled artifact. Run the squash pass, verify the image is under 90 MB, and smoke-test locally against the Pellwick staging mesh. Once the image passes, update the runtime settings to match the values below.

settings of faweg-bahop:
[wenvan]
port = 5000
team = belax
host = wenvan.qorvelsys.test
region = east-1
access_code = ac_020232
timeout_ms = 1500